Overly Realistic

Introduces overly-realistic game mechanics, making the game extremely hard and time-consuming, as to incentivize players to cooperate

  • Added new visual & auditory feedback for wisdom skill experience gains
    • When gaining wisdom skill experience, a stylized text will appear under the player's crosshair and a xylophone tune/sound will be played, informing the player they have gained experience in a certain skill for performing the action that they were performing
    • The sound played can be configured with 4 possible options
    • The method of which the player is informed can be configured, with 3 possible options
  • Added a new type of settings menu: "Player Settings"
    • These settings apply per-player, instead of applying to all players or the game itself
    • Unlike general settings, users don't need operator permissions to access player settings
    • The player settings menu currently has 2 setting categories: "Sounds" and "UI"
  • Rehauled the settings overview screen
    • The settings overview will now show the player 2 buttons
      • The "Player Settings" button will show the player all "player settings" setting categories, these are the new per-player setting categories
      • The "General Settings" button will show the player all the "general settings" setting categories, these are all the (previous) setting categories, that apply to the game itself
  • Added 2 new settings
    • Added the "XP Gain" setting
      • This is a player setting, located under "Sounds", its' options are word-based instead of true/false values, it is set to "Xylo" by default
      • Its options are: "Xylo" , "Ding" , "Upgrade" , "Off"
        • The "Xylo"/"Ding"/"Upgrade" options set different sounds to be played upon gaining skill experience
        • The "Off" option will disable auditory feedback when gaining skill experience
      • This setting controls what sound the player hears when receiving a skill-experience-gain notification
    • Added the "XP Notice" setting
      • This is a player setting, located under "UI", its' options are word-based instead of true/false values, it is set to "UI" by default
      • Its options are: "UI" , "Chat" , "Off"
        • When set to UI, users are shown a small UI element under their crosshair when gaining skill experience
        • When set to Chat, users are sent a message in chat when gaining skill experience
        • When set to Off, users will not be visually notified when gaining skill experience
      • This setting controls how players are visually notified of increases to their wisdom skills
  • Added new tips
    • Added a new tip that is triggered by being near an exposed player corpse, it informs the user of the affects of such event
    • Added a new tip that is triggered by harvesting a player corpse, it informs the user of the sanity decrease from doing so
  • Created new system for specialized operations being run upon specific blocks being mined
  • Multiple players are now able to be registered as someone who "has sharpened a tool in a whetstone"
    • Previously, only the player who last interacted with a whetstone indicator would be registered as such
    • This condition is used for the stonecraft skill level requirements
  • Changed certain aspects regarding log-stripping times
    • Removed the checks for solid blocks above logs that was previously used for longer log-stripping times
    • It now takes a longer time for logs to be stripped if there is another regular log either above or below the block being stripped
  • Stripped logs can now be harvested quicker than regular logs
  • Increased, very slightly, the amount of mining skill experience players get from mining copper ore
  • Players will now get mining experience for every 3 ore blocks (of the same type) broken, instead of 10
  • Coarse dirt can now be turned into mud when dropped into water
  • Players no longer get blacksmithing experience from creating stone tools
  • Increased the illness chance increase gained from eating spoiled foods and raw meats
  • Decreased the Y coordinate levels needed for the application of stamina decreases for certain actions, the amount of stamina decreased has also now been increased
    • The new heights & stamina decrease values are detailed below:
      • Y=75-Y=89 -> -1 stamina per action
      • Y=90-Y=109 -> -3 stamina per action
      • Y=110+ -> -5 stamina per action
    • Such decreases apply to placing weighted blocks, knapping, iron-forging, combat, climbing, jumping, sprinting, and log-stripping
  • Players who stay near player corpses who are exposed to the air will now have their sanity decrease and will have an increased chance to gain illnesses
  • Harvesting player corpses will now decrease sanity
  • Removed the decorated pot requirement for the chest recipe
  • Player corpses will now despawn in 4.5 minutes instead of 10 if their items have already been collected
  • Slightly optimized tool creation
  • Slightly optimized XP orb entity operations
  • Slightly optimized player corpse hit operations
  • Optimized equidae-riding checks
  • Optimized altitude checks
  • Fixed short bows turning into dry whetstones when being crafted in a preparation plate
  • Fixed the game sometimes not detecting players mining copper ore blocks
  • Fixed lapis ore not giving players mining experience upon being mined
  • Fixed lapis ore not having a chance to drop cobblestone/cobbled deepslate
  • Fixed tool data for axes being incorrect
  • Fixed the numerals in the "My Skills" tooltip, in the secondary wisdom skills menu, being off-center
  • Fixed the equitation line in the "My Skills" tooltip, in the sub-skills wisdom skills menu, wrongfully using the archery skill icon
  • Fixed certain wisdom skill level requirements mentioning 8 possible tools that must be created, instead of 9
  • Fixed players only ever receiving scribing experience as a bonus for leveling up near a player with a scribery level of 4+
  • Fixed leaf piles not being able to be used as fuel for campfires
    • (Note: This might not apply to leaf piles gathered in previous updates)
  • Fixed players not receiving the chest recipe in their recipe book when acquiring planks
  • Fixed players not receiving the decorated pot recipe in their recipe book when acquiring clay balls
  • Fixed player corpses not dropping their items when harvested with an improper item or with an empty hand
  • Fixed animals sometimes getting stuck in certain situations inside leaves
  • Fixed high quality ores not dropping if they were mined in cave biomes under their properly-assigned biomes
